Pakistan has right to defend itself from terrorism: US
author avatar
4 Jan 2023 - 17:16

KABUL (Pajhwok): The US Department of State has said that Pakistan had the right to defend its self from terrorism and asked the acting Afghan government to uphold commitment they had mad that their soil would never be used as a Launchpad for international terrorist attacks.

At a press briefing on Tuesday, the US State Department Spokesperson Ned Price said: “The Pakistani people have suffered tremendously from terrorist attacks. Pakistan has a right to defend itself from terrorism,”

“These are among the very commitments that the Taliban have been unable or unwilling to fulfill to date,” he added.

Earlier, Pakistan’s National Security meeting asked Afghanistan’s rulers — without directly naming them — to deny safe haven to Pakistani terrorist groups on its soil and end their patronage, while reiterating its intent to crush terrorist groups operating inside the country with full force.

Pakistan Interior Minister Rana Sanaullah also warned if Afghanistan failed to act against TTP bases in in Afghanistan, Pakistan might target them on its own.

‌But, the ‘Islamic Emirate of Afghanistan’ (IEA) has urged Pakistan to refrain from provoking statements and stressed over the resolution of problems through dialogue.

Acting IEA Spokesperson Zabihullah Mujahid on hit Twitter handle wrote “The Islamic Emirate of Afghanistan wants peaceful relations with all its neighboring countries, including Pakistan and believes in all the ways that can lead to achieve this goal.”

He added: “We are committed to this goal, but the Pakistani side also has a responsibility to resolve the situation, avoid baseless talks and provocative ideas, because such talks and mistrust are not in the interest of any side.”

The IEA spokesperson said: “As the Islamic Emirate values peace and stability in Afghanistan, it wants peace and stability for the entire region and continues its efforts in this regard.”
